Network Neuroscience and the History of Curiosity

In the history of philosophy, curiosity has been seen as an individual capacity to acquire knowledge. But in network neuroscience, we see it as a practice of connection. When we are curious, we want to connect what we know right now with what we are about to know. So this, I think, is a much richer understanding of curiosity and lets us ask much more interesting questions.
